                      DELTEK(R) SYSTEMS ACQUIRES SEMAPHORE

MCLEAN, VIRGINIA - AUGUST 10, 2000 - DELTEK SYSTEMS, INC. (NASDAQ: DLTK)
(WWW.DELTEK.COM). Deltek(R), a leading provider of enterprise software to
professional services industries, today announced it has acquired Semaphore,
Inc., a major developer and distributor of advanced financial and project
management software and services for over 2,000 professional services firms.

        Deltek purchased all of the outstanding stock of Semaphore, Inc. for a
price of $10 million in cash pursuant to an Agreement and Plan of Merger.
Semaphore recorded $8.5 million of revenue for 1999 and $4.7 million for the
six-month period ended June 30, 2000.

        Semaphore has an active customer base of over 2,000 architecture and
engineering firms of all sizes, from small firms to major corporations with
multiple locations and large-scale, complex projects. Its customers are among
the most well known firms in the architecture, engineering and construction
(A/E/C) industry, including The Thornton-Tomasetti Group Inc. (formerly The LZA
Group Inc.); Greenhorne & O'Mara; Garver Engineers; Huiit-Zollars, Inc.;
Technical Associates; Rummel Klepper Kahl; and Tompson, Ventulett, Stainback and
Associates, Inc.

ABOUT SEMAPHORE, INC.

        Founded in 1984, Semaphore is a leading developer and distributor of
advanced financial and project management software and services for A/E/C and
other professional services firms. Semaphore has over 2,000 architecture,
engineering and other professional services firms of all sizes, from independent
offices to major corporations with multiple locations and large-scale, complex
projects. The company's products have been recognized in the Architectural
Record's Annual Product Reports for the most dramatic product innovations in
client and project tracking, and the firm was recently named as one of the
nation's fastest growing technology companies in the National Technology Fast
500(R). Semaphore is headquartered in New York, NY, with offices in St. Paul,
MN, Tigard, OR, and Diamond Bar, CA.

ABOUT DELTEK(R) SYSTEMS, INC.

        Deltek is a leading provider of business software, solutions and
consulting to over 5,500 professional services firms and project-based companies
worldwide. Deltek's solutions encompass project and financial accounting,
customer relationship management, time collection and employee expense, proposal
automation, project and resource management, human resources and payroll,
business intelligence, and e-Business. The company's 700 dedicated professionals
have extensive insight, knowledge and experience in all areas of professional
services automation. Integrated services include premium-level customer support
and software maintenance, implementation and practice management consulting, and
